How much do operations ass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 21, 2026, the average hourly pay for operations assistant in Liverpool, NY is $19.03,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.76 and $21.49 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an operations assistant?

An operations assistant takes care of a variety of administrative and clerical responsibilities for an organization. Their purpose is to help ensure the business runs smoothly by resolving customer complaints, training employees, and assisting management. As an operations assistant, you can work in a wide variety of industries, and your specific duties vary depending upon the job field. This career requires industry-specific work experience, as well as strong interpersonal skills. Some medical employers require additional qualifications, such as an associate degree in a related field.

What is the difference between Operations Assistant vs Administrative Assistant?

AspectOperations AssistantAdministrative Assistant
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ma; some roles may prefer certifications in office managementHigh school diploma; often requires proficiency in office software
Work EnvironmentCorporate offices, warehouses, or production facilitiesOffice settings, reception areas
Employer & Industry UsageManufacturing, logistics, retail, corporateCorporate, government, nonprofit, small businesses
Common Search & ComparisonOperations Assistant vs Administrative Assistant

The main difference is that Operations Assistants focus on supporting daily operational functions, logistics, and process improvements, often in more technical or production environments. Administrative Assistants primarily handle clerical tasks, scheduling, and office management. Both roles require organizational skills and basic office credentials, but Operations Assistants tend to work more closely with operational teams and processes.

Worldpac, a leading name in automotive parts distribution, is looking for a Branch Operations Lead that will be responsible for assisting Assistant Branch Operations Manager and Branch Operations Manager in leading daily warehouse operations.

What You Will Contribute at Worldpac 

  • Works closely with management team to learn all functions of Branch Management, including operations, staffing, training, branch assets, expense management and budgeting.   

  • Reviews, understands and follows company safety and security procedures, and serves as a role model to ensure compliance by all team members.   

  • Supports team members in their training and development and enables immediate application to daily work.  

  • Maintains a customer service-oriented philosophy in all conduct to self and other team members.  

  • Reports violations of company policies and procedures and safety concerns to management team.   

  • Coordinates and communicates with management team to ensure orders are delivered, inventory is maintained, and records are prepared and stored accordingly.   

  • Uses vehicle to deliver orders or pick up returned merchandise in a safe and courteous manner.     

  • Other duties may be assigned.

Physical/Work Environment Expectations:  

  • While performing the duties of this job, the team member is regularly exposed to moving mechanical parts and occasionally exposed to high places, fumes, or airborne particles, and toxic or caustic chemicals. The noise level in the work environment is generally high (loud). 

  • While performing the duties of this job, the team member is regularly required to stand, walk, use hands and fingers, reach with arms, talk, and listen. The team member is frequently required to stoop, kneel, and crouch and occasionally required to sit, climb, or balance. The team member must be able to regularly lift and/or move up to 25 pounds, frequently lift and/or move up to 50 pounds, and occasionally lift and/or move up to 100 pounds.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, and ability to adjust focus.
